This print showcases the emblem of the Spanish Inquisition, a powerful symbol that evokes both fear and fascination. Created by an unknown artist in the 17th century, this intricate engraving features a combination of religious and militaristic elements. At its center lies a prominent cross, representing the dominant role of Catholicism during this dark period in Spanish history. Surrounding it are an olive branch and a sword, symbolizing peace and justice respectively. This juxtaposition highlights the dual nature of the Inquisition's mission - to maintain order within society while eradicating any perceived threats to orthodoxy. The meticulous details captured in this print allow us to delve into Spain's complex past and reflect upon its religious fervor. The image serves as a reminder of how religion can be used as both a unifying force and a weapon for persecution.
